18 Stunning Powder Room Transformations

Powder rooms may be small, but they hold incredible potential to make a lasting impression. With a little creativity, this compact space can be transformed into a show-stopping corner of your home. From bold wallpapers to clever storage, a stunning powder room transformation can reflect your personality and elevate your interior style. Here are 18 inspiring ideas to spark your imagination.

1. Dramatic Wallpaper

Adding bold wallpaper is one of the quickest ways to give your powder room a dramatic transformation. Choose oversized florals, metallic patterns, or geometric prints to create instant visual impact in this small but important space.

2. Floating Vanity

A floating vanity makes the room feel more open and modern. It saves floor space and allows you to highlight beautiful flooring, creating the illusion of a larger powder room.

3. Statement Mirror

Replacing a plain mirror with a statement piece can instantly change the look. Think of gold-framed ovals, intricate wood carvings, or even irregularly shaped designs for an artistic touch.

4. Bold Paint Colors

Rich colors like navy blue, emerald green, or deep charcoal can make a powder room feel luxurious. Pair with metallic accents or light fixtures to balance the depth of color.

FAQs

How do I make a small powder room look bigger?
Use light colors, large mirrors, and floating vanities to create an illusion of space. Minimalist designs also help prevent the room from feeling cramped.

What is the best lighting for a powder room?
Wall sconces on either side of the mirror or a statement overhead light work beautifully. Choose warm lighting to create an inviting glow.

Can I use dark colors in a powder room?
Yes, dark colors can create a dramatic and luxurious feel. Pair them with metallic accents and proper lighting to avoid a cramped look.

What type of flooring works best for powder rooms?
Tile, stone, or waterproof vinyl are excellent options. Bold patterns can also enhance the small space without overwhelming it.

How can I give my powder room a luxury feel on a budget?
Focus on small updates like swapping the mirror, upgrading hardware, or adding wallpaper to one feature wall. Even minor changes can have a big impact.
